At today’s DICE Summit, a gathering of industry veterans paid tribute to Call of Duty and Titanfall co-creator Vince Zampella, who died in December. Joining the likes of Todd Howard, Randy Pitchford and Ted Price was Hideo Kojima, who, according to Gamefile, sought advice from Zampella when founding his own studio Kojima Productions.

“He gave me a lot of support and advice,” Kojima said. “He showed me his studio, and I incorporated some of the good aspects into our own studio.”
